Q: What qualification did John F Kennedy look for as he chose his cabinet?

What position did Robert Kennedy have in John Kennedy's cabinet?

Robert Kennedy served as the United States Attorney General in John F. Kennedy's cabinet.

Who did Kennedy choose for is running mate?

John Fitzgerald Kennedy chose Texan politician Lyndon B. Johnson for his running mate in the 1960 US presidential election against Richard M. Nixon.
